== Installation ==
=== Preparation ===
The following instructions are written for a new installation of Funtoo Linux performed using the [[Install]] guide.
 
==== Funtoo Profiles ====
Correctly setting [[Funtoo Profiles]] is required to install KDE. Review the selected profiles using epro.
 
{{console|body=
###i## epro show
}}
 
The recommended flavor for KDE is ''desktop''. This can be selected with the following command.
 
{{console|body=
###i## epro flavor desktop
}}
 
With the flavor has been set to ''desktop'', update Funtoo with the following command.
 
{{console|body=
###i## emerge --ask --update --verbose --deep --newuse --with-bdeps=y @world
}}
 
{{tip|This command can be shorted to
 
{{console|body=
###i## emerge -auvDN --with-bdeps=y @world
}}
}}
 
==== Install the X Window System ====
KDE requires the X Window System (X11) to handle video and input devices (e.g. keyboard, mouse). Configuration is required in order for X11 to work with your particular video card. Use the [[Video]] guide to determine the appropriate VIDEO_CARDS entry for your install of Funtoo Linux. Using your favorite editor, edit make.conf to include the setting that you wish to apply.
 
{{file|name=/etc/portage/make.conf|desc=example for Intel HD Graphics|body=
VIDEO_CARDS="intel i965"
}}
 
Now install the X Window System with the following command.
 
{{console|body=
###i## emerge --ask ---verbose x11-base/xorg-x11
}}
 
Optional: To install KDE for a language other than English (United States) add an appropriate LINGUAS entry to make.conf.
 
{{file|name=/etc/portage/make.conf|desc=Example for English (United Kingdom)|body=
LINGUAS="en_GB"
}}

==== KDE Plasma 5 ====
This will result in a minimal desktop environment based on KDE Plasma 5. Additional packages will need to be installed manually in order to provide a 'complete' desktop environment.
 
Earlier you set your [[Funtoo Profiles|Profiles]] to use the ''desktop'' flavor. Now you must add a [[Funtoo Profiles|mix-in]] in order to ensure the smooth installation of KDE. There are two KDE-related mix-ins available in Funtoo: ''kde'' and ''kde-plasma-5''.
 
{{important|A mix-in for KDE Plasma 5 - ''kde-plasma-5'' - is currently not available as validation testing is still ongoing. See [https://bugs.funtoo.org/browse/FL-2373 FL-2373]. (4-Nov-2015)}}
 
'''The mix-in required for KDE Plasma 5 is ''kde-plasma-5''. Do NOT use ''kde''.''' Add the mix-in using epro
 
{{console|body=
###i## epro mix-in kde-plasma-5
}}
 
You are now ready to install KDE SC 4. With the Profile change (added mix-in) you must update the world set of packages, as well as merge KDE. This can be performed as two separate commands
 
{{console|body=
###i## emerge -auvDN --with-bdeps=y @world
}}
 
followed by
 
{{console|body=
###i## emerge --ask kde-plasma/plasma-meta
}}
 
or alternatively in one line
 
{{console|body=
###i## emerge -auvDN --with-bdeps=y @world kde-plasma/plasma-meta
}}
 
Unlike the KDE SC 4 meta-package (kde-base/kde-meta) merging kde-plasma/plasma-meta on its own does not install additional core applications such as a file manager or terminal emulator. The following KDE Applications 5 are available in Funtoo Linux
 
* kde-apps/dolphin (File Manager for KDE Plasma desktops)
* kde-apps/kate (An advanced text editor for KDE)
* kde-apps/konsole (KDE's terminal emulator)
 
Merge these using one command
 
{{console|body=
###i## emerge --ask kde-apps/dolphin kde-apps/kate kde-apps/konsole
}}

== Configure and Start KDE ==
 
=== OpenRC ===
After the many packages have been merged there will be a variety of post-install messages. Some of these request that critical services must be started in order for KDE to work. Typically these are ALSA (media-libs/alsa-lib), ConsoleKit (sys-auth/consolekit), DBus (sys-apps/dbus), and UDev (sys-fs/eudev). If the  ''desktop'' flavor has been set then CUPS (net-print/cups) will also be included.
 
As a minimum execute the following series of commands to start services automatically via OpenRC
 
{{console|body=
###i## rc-update add alsasound boot
###i## rc-update add cupsd default
###i## rc-update add consolekit default
}}
 
DBus is usually started when these services start.
 
UDev is usually rebuilt during an install of KDE due to changes in USE flags from changing Profile. To accommodate changes it is best to restart the service.
 
{{console|body=
###i## /etc/init.d/udev --nodeps restart
}}
 
{{tip|Do not confuse the UDev package '''eudev''' (sys-fs/eudev) with '''evdev'''! '''evdev''' is the generic input device driver for the X Window System (x11-drivers/xf86-input-evdev)!}}
 
=== Create a User Account ===
Now is a good point to create a  user account in addition to ''root''. The following example creates a user ''alice'' and associates that account with the Groups ''games'', ''ld'', ''ldadmin'', ''plugdev'', ''users'', ''video'' and ''wheel''. A home directory for the account ''alice'' will be created at /home/alice.
 
{{console|body=
###i## useradd -m -G games,ld,ldadmin,plugdev,users,video,wheel alice
}}
 
Now set a password for ''alice''
 
{{console|body=
###i## passwd alice
}}

'''KDE Plasma 5'''
 
Using SDDM
 
Use SDDM to create a new config file.
{{console|body=
###i## sddm --example-config > /etc/sddm.conf
}}
 
Edit the SDDM configuration to use the KDE Plasma 5 theme 'breeze'.
{{file|name=/etc/sddm.conf|desc=Change the line Current= |body=
 
[Theme]
# Current theme name
Current=breeze
 
}}
 
Edit xdm configuration
{{file|name=/etc/conf.d/xdm|body=
DISPLAYMANAGER="sddm"
}}
 
Add xdm to the default runlevel and start.
{{console|body=
###i## rc-update add xdm default
###i## rc
}}
